Description The Phlebotomist I is responsible for safely and efficiently collecting venous and capillary blood samples and a variety of other specimen types from pediatric, adolescent, adult, and geriatric patients utilizing approved techniques for diagnostic testing. This role ensures proper patient identification, specimen labeling, and adherence to infection control and safety protocols. The incumbent collaborates with nursing, laboratory, and other clinical staff to provide timely and accurate specimen collection, supporting quality patient care and laboratory operations. The Phlebotomist performs other laboratory duties including use of the laboratory computer system, answering phones, receiving patients, communicating laboratory data to ordering parties, maintaining a filing system, and providing data collection support. Primary Duties and Responsibilities Collects blood and other specimens from patients using venipuncture, capillary puncture, or other approved methods according to hospital protocols. Verifies patient identity and ensures proper labeling of specimens to maintain accuracy and prevent errors. Maintains patient comfort and safety during specimen collection, addressing patient concerns and minimizing discomfort. Prepares specimens for transport to the laboratory as appropriate, including proper handling, storage, and documentation and distributes samples to designated sections within the department. Enters patient and specimen information and orders accurately into electronic medical records (EMR) or laboratory information systems (LIS) and supports the patient record keeping system for the laboratory. Prepares and maintains equipment and supplies, ensuring proper functioning and replenishment as needed. Communicates effectively with patients, families, nurses, and laboratory staff regarding specimen collection procedures and any issues. Follows infection control and safety procedures, including the use of personal protective equipment (PPE) and adherence to bloodborne pathogen exposure protocols.
